Expanded Format for 2024/25 UEFA Nations League

The 2024/25 UEFA Nations League will introduce a new knockout round in March 2025, expanding the tournament’s scope and ensuring competitive football throughout the season. This new stage will feature quarter-finals for League A, where group winners and runners-up will face off in a home-and-away format. Winners of these ties will proceed to the “Final Four,” scheduled for June 2025, where the ultimate champion will be crowned.

Key Dates and Group Stages

The 2024/25 UEFA Nations League kicks off on September 5, 2024, with six match days running through to November 19, 2024. These games will determine the group winners and runners-up, setting the stage for the knockout rounds. The quarterfinals will be organized in March 2025, followed by the final tournament in June 2025 ​(UEFA.com).​

Each team will play six group matches, with two games per international window. This creates a packed schedule that ensures every point matters, making the competition fiercely contested from start to finish.

League A Teams: The Ones to Watch

League A features some of the strongest national teams in Europe, divided into four groups. Powerhouses like Spain, France, Italy, and Germany will be battling. It is in this top division. The competition promises high-stakes matchups, as teams strive not only for glory but also to avoid relegation to League B.

With Spain entering as the defending champions, having won the 2023 final against Croatia, the stakes are even higher as teams look to dethrone the reigning champions (UEFA.com). Expect intense encounters between these top-tier nations as they aim for a spot in the prestigious Final Four.

Promotion, Relegation, and the Road to Euro 2028

While League A steals much of the spotlight, the lower leagues will be equally competitive. The promotion and relegation system ensures that teams in Leagues B, C, and D also have plenty to play for. The group winners in Leagues B and C will earn promotion to the higher tier, while fourth-placed teams face relegation ​(UEFA.com).

Moreover, teams’ performances in the Nations League will also impact their seeding for the Euro 2028 qualifiers, adding further significance to every match. This dual incentive means that every fixture, even in the lower leagues, carries weight in the broader European football landscape.

The Nations League: A Path to Meaningful Matches

The UEFA Nations League was introduced to provide more meaningful international fixtures, replacing less competitive friendlies with high-stakes, evenly-matched contests. With its promotion-relegation system, the tournament ensures that teams of similar strength face each other, increasing competitiveness and fan engagement. The 2024/25 edition will uphold this tradition, offering a mix of established giants and emerging teams battling across Europe ​(UEFA.com).
